草庐IT

Frameworks

全部标签

android - 为什么使用单线程模型作为主线程来更新 UI?

Qt文档说,Asmentioned,eachprogramhasonethreadwhenitisstarted.Thisthreadiscalledthe"mainthread"(alsoknownasthe"GUIthread"inQtapplications).TheQtGUImustruninthisthread.Android文档说,Likeactivitiesandtheothercomponents,servicesruninthemainthreadoftheapplicationprocess和iOS,Itisstronglyrecommendednottoupdat

ios - 制作一个 iOS 框架 : including 3rd party libraries and code

我正在制作一个静态iOS框架。我想使用第3方代码,让我们在我的框架中使用AFNetworking作为示例。AFNetworking很流行。我现在可以感觉到namespace冲突。这里的最佳做法是什么?据我所知,我有3个选择:1)将AFNetworking构建到我的框架中,导出header。这让客户可以使用我的库中的AFNetworking版本,但他们不能使用也链接AFNetworking的其他框架。如果他们在AFNetworking上构建,他们依靠我更新AFNetworking。2)针对AFNetworkingheader的代码,但让第三方在他们的项目中包含AFNetworking。这

ios - 制作一个 iOS 框架 : including 3rd party libraries and code

我正在制作一个静态iOS框架。我想使用第3方代码,让我们在我的框架中使用AFNetworking作为示例。AFNetworking很流行。我现在可以感觉到namespace冲突。这里的最佳做法是什么?据我所知,我有3个选择:1)将AFNetworking构建到我的框架中,导出header。这让客户可以使用我的库中的AFNetworking版本,但他们不能使用也链接AFNetworking的其他框架。如果他们在AFNetworking上构建,他们依靠我更新AFNetworking。2)针对AFNetworkingheader的代码,但让第三方在他们的项目中包含AFNetworking。这

ios - 删除 "Embedded binary"后,Xcode 不会添加 "DerivedData"

辅助搜索的替代标题:在Xcode中添加嵌入式二进制文件失败Xcode不会从单独的项目链接框架应用程序由于缺少框架而在设备上崩溃,但可以在模拟器中运行概览在xcode6中删除“DerivedData”文件夹(或执行“Product>Clean”)后,我无法将另一个项目的CocoaTouch框架添加到“嵌入式二进制文件”部分(在“常规”选项卡下)。或者,Xcode遇到链接器错误,因为它找不到以前可以找到的框架。其他症状单击“嵌入式二进制文件”下的+会显示框架选择器,但在工作区的不同项目中选择框架不会执行任何操作。 最佳答案 当您将框架添

ios - 删除 "Embedded binary"后,Xcode 不会添加 "DerivedData"

辅助搜索的替代标题:在Xcode中添加嵌入式二进制文件失败Xcode不会从单独的项目链接框架应用程序由于缺少框架而在设备上崩溃,但可以在模拟器中运行概览在xcode6中删除“DerivedData”文件夹(或执行“Product>Clean”)后,我无法将另一个项目的CocoaTouch框架添加到“嵌入式二进制文件”部分(在“常规”选项卡下)。或者,Xcode遇到链接器错误,因为它找不到以前可以找到的框架。其他症状单击“嵌入式二进制文件”下的+会显示框架选择器,但在工作区的不同项目中选择框架不会执行任何操作。 最佳答案 当您将框架添

ios - Parse.framework iOS 链接错误

我尝试在我的项目中导入解析框架。我确定我的项目喜欢它,但我找不到任何关于它是否“电弧敏感”的信息。我的项目是基于弧线的。这是我遇到的错误:Undefinedsymbolsforarchitecturei386:"_SCNetworkReachabilityCreateWithName",referencedfrom:-[PFCommandCacheinit]inParse(PFCommandCache.o)+[PFInternalUtils(Reachability)isParseReachable]inParse(PFInternalUtils.o)"_SCNetworkReacha

ios - Parse.framework iOS 链接错误

我尝试在我的项目中导入解析框架。我确定我的项目喜欢它,但我找不到任何关于它是否“电弧敏感”的信息。我的项目是基于弧线的。这是我遇到的错误:Undefinedsymbolsforarchitecturei386:"_SCNetworkReachabilityCreateWithName",referencedfrom:-[PFCommandCacheinit]inParse(PFCommandCache.o)+[PFInternalUtils(Reachability)isParseReachable]inParse(PFInternalUtils.o)"_SCNetworkReacha

iphone - 在 iOS 的动态框架中包含一个静态库

我需要为我正在从事的项目创建一个框架(这需要一个静态库)。我用了thistutorial创建框架,然后将静态库复制到项目中并运行。但是,当我将框架拖到iOS项目时,它显示了大量错误。`Undefinedsymbolsforarchitecturei386:"_OBJC_CLASS_$_SomeClassFromTheStaticLibrary",referencedfrom:_OBJC_CLASS_$_AnotherClassinMyFramework`我认为正在发生的事情是iOS项目想要重新编译框架但它不能,因为它找不到静态库。如果我将静态库添加到iOS项目,所有错误都会消失。这是我

iphone - 在 iOS 的动态框架中包含一个静态库

我需要为我正在从事的项目创建一个框架(这需要一个静态库)。我用了thistutorial创建框架,然后将静态库复制到项目中并运行。但是,当我将框架拖到iOS项目时,它显示了大量错误。`Undefinedsymbolsforarchitecturei386:"_OBJC_CLASS_$_SomeClassFromTheStaticLibrary",referencedfrom:_OBJC_CLASS_$_AnotherClassinMyFramework`我认为正在发生的事情是iOS项目想要重新编译框架但它不能,因为它找不到静态库。如果我将静态库添加到iOS项目,所有错误都会消失。这是我

ios - "Embedded dylibs/frameworks only run on iOS 8 or later"警告的后果

在Xcode6.x中,我们可以使用CocoaTouchFramework模板来构建框架库,Xcode会在我们构建时为我们创建.framework,这非常棒。在我们的框架中,我们希望支持iOS7.1及更高版本,因此对于部署目标(在我们的框架中),我们指定了7.1。现在,当我们构建时,我们会看到一条警告:“嵌入式dylibs/frameworks仅在iOS8或更高版本上运行”。从那以后,我阅读了很多关于这个主题的博客文章,就在iOS7.1上运行它而言,这个警告可以忽略,因为它会运行良好(仍然需要测试以确保)。让我担心的是,我在StackOverflow上阅读了一篇帖子,其中说应用程序可能会